Hi, I'm new to the forums, my name is Steve and I am in St Louis MO. I own two Celbrities., a blonde stereo model (A0794) with tortoise guards and a red burst (A0772) with white guards. I believe that they are both Celebrity "ones". I got the blonde one just over a year ago from the grandson of the original owner who had passed away, and instantly loved it. The other I purchased yesterday at a local vintage guitar shop, and they had gotten it from the original owner, or so they said. Both have the original Victoria luggage co. cases. I'm in my early thirties, and my first guitar, ca. '93-4, was a heavy metal style axe with a very thin neck, so the oddly thin and flat neck profile on these guitars feels right to me. I've never quite hit it off with a fatter neck which were more common in the '60s. Here's some pics, any info that anyone on here would like to provide will be much appreciated, so don't hold back. Also, I almost have to wonder, since the serial #s are 22 digits apart, if these were part of the same shipment to the St Louis area, or if they found their seperate ways here. Anyway...
